Reports Report 1561afa (Event 1561-2019)

Observer
Name Laticia B
Experience Level 1/5
Remarks It was whitish yellow and blinky (pulsating)as it moved across the sky with a long whiteish tail..large shooting star..(reminded me of a firework about to exspode) it wasnt straight in the sky it was in a downwards angle..looked so close as if it was going to hit some where in Charlotte NC..(to hold my fingers up to catch it) It was about 3inches long.HOPE this helped
